Solola men’s ceremonial (cofradía society) jacket.
55 cm across the shoulders. 50 cm length. 54 cm arm length. This circa 1980 men’s ceremonial jacket was hand woven on a back strap loom in 2 colors of hand spun, undyed wool. It is extensively decorated with applique. The back features the bat design as its central motif. These jackets are worn ceremonially by male members of the Sololá cofradía societies.
